#BuildingHope

Share how the new Calgary Cancer Centre is building hope.

Click on 'add your idea' below to upload a photo along with a brief description about why it represents hope. 

Through images taken by patients, families, AHS staff, physicians and the general public, #buildinghope will share snapshots of hope, courage, research, partnership, community, etc. The snapshots can be of a simple portrait, a pink ribbon, a mother with her child – examples of what Albertans see the building representing, or building for them. 

Once received, a selection of these photos will be chosen by AHS to become part of a photo mosaic that spells the word HOPE.  As the CCC is being built, the mosaic will take shape and grow, such that in the end, the full mosaic will be displayed in a prominent location in the CCC.
